Some properties of second order Wiener filter are discussed. It is assumed that the observed stationary process is a nonlinear transformation of a Gaussian white noise. This transformation is a sum of a linear and quadratic form of the input sequence and is characterized by corresponding kernels. The main problem is to identify the kernels. In order to solve this problem authors suggest to use the sequence of the second and third moments of the observed process which are explicitly calculated. Corresponding spectral densities are also given.
